I never run anything buy 5w30. I even bought the Corvette oil cap, and I am pretty sure it even says 5w30 on it. 5w30 Mobil 1 is excellent, and I get awesome oil pressure. I won;t even consider switching to a heavier weight oil until I get a lot more miles on the car. I am sitting at 34k miles right now.
